Smart Climate Sensors
Smart weather sensing units have actually revolutionized the performance of contemporary watering systems by adjusting watering timetables based on real-time environmental information. These sensors keep an eye on variables such as temperature, humidity, wind rate, and solar radiation, enabling systems to respond dynamically to altering weather. By incorporating this information, wise sensing units can optimize water use, reducing waste and ensuring that landscapes receive the appropriate amount of moisture. This modern technology not just conserves water however additionally advertises much healthier plant development by preventing overwatering or underwatering. Additionally, the automation supplied by smart weather condition sensors enhances customer convenience, as landscaping companies and house owners can rely upon specific watering schedules without hand-operated treatment. Soil Dampness Sensors
Dirt moisture sensing units play a necessary duty in contemporary irrigation systems, supplying real-time information that enhances water effectiveness. These tools measure the volumetric water web content in the soil, enabling accurate assessments of dampness degrees. By integrating soil moisture sensing units right into watering systems, customers can prevent overwatering or underwatering, eventually advertising much healthier plant growth and saving water resources.The sensing units send data to controllers, which can adjust watering routines based on current soil conditions. This data-driven strategy decreases water waste and warranties that plants get the most effective amount of dampness. In addition, dirt moisture sensors can be useful in numerous farming setups, from home yards to large ranches. The release of these sensors adds to sustainable practices by sustaining responsible water use and decreasing environmental impact.
